Welcome to the Harrowfield support rotation. The FieldPulse telemetry gateway relays sensor data from tractors and irrigation rigs to our cloud ingest tier. Before touching production, complete the sandbox walkthrough and shadow two live cases. Should the gateway admin panel ever lock you out after failed attempts, you will need the recovery passphrase noted directly below.

recovery phrase for fawif-tajeg: norael-aldmir-casir-brivan-ulaion

# Environment Variables: Bulk Edits in the Admin Table

The Quillbranch admin console now supports bulk edits of environment variables through the table view. Select rows with the checkbox column, then apply a change set; edits are staged and validated before commit, and any row failing validation aborts the whole batch. Note for the sync: bulk edits never display secret values, only masked placeholders, so verify changes via the audit log. Staging validation itself authenticates with a service credential, which is set immediately below.

sealed setting: COURIER_KEY29=170ad45524657711572101e080d15

Changed defaults in Splitfork, our assignment service. Bucketing now uses sticky hashing per account instead of per session, and the holdout slice grew from 2% to 5%. Callers relying on session-level reassignment must opt in explicitly. Review the diff against the new baseline; the updated default configuration is listed below.

config for tagep-kajof:
[casir]
port = 6379
region = south-1
host = casir.paliqdyn.example
team = tamax
timeout_ms = 250
retries = 2

Hello plugin authors,

Next Thursday, Corbexa will run a disaster-recovery drill for the RestockRoute vending-machine restock planner. During the failover window, plugin callbacks will be replayed against the standby scheduler, so please ensure your handlers are idempotent and tolerate duplicate route assignments. No customer restock data will be altered. To re-register your plugin against the standby environment during the drill, authenticate with the recovery passphrase provided below.

vault phrase of hahip-tajeg = quenax-briath-briax